    Abstract: An electrical connector includes a case, and a plurality of ground units and transmission units alternately arranged in the case side by side. The transmission units respectively have a plurality of transmission members and a plurality of ground members for reducing mutual signal interference between the transmission units. Alternatively, at least one coupling unit is coupled to the ground units for reducing mutual signal interference between the transmission units. The ground units, the ground members and the coupling unit provide the function of preventing electromagnetic interference and crosstalk, so that the electrical connector can have increased signal transmission rate. With the above arrangements, the electrical connector also has simplified structure and is easy to assemble.

    Abstract: A connector structure includes an enclosure; a plurality of ground units arranged in the enclosure and respectively including a carrier plate and a plurality of ground terminals electrically connected to one another and associated with the carrier plate; a plurality of signal units arranged in the enclosure side by side to locate between any two adjacent ones of the ground units, and the signal units respectively including a carrier plate and a plurality of signal terminals associated with the carrier plate; and a ground connecting member connected to the carrier plates of the ground units and the signal units. With these arrangements, the connector has simple structure and can be easily assembled for use, and the ground units are connected to the ground connecting member to thereby effectively prevent electromagnetic interference during signal transmission and ensure increased transmission rate.

    Abstract: A pull-out structure for connector includes a connector and a pull unit. The connector has a locking unit movably arranged thereon and the locking unit includes a retaining section located at a rear end thereof. The pull unit includes an insertion section located at a lower front end thereof, and is engaged with the locking unit by inserting the insertion section into the retaining section of the locking unit. The pull unit and the locking unit have sufficient structural strength. When it is necessary to replace or remove the connector from a shielding cage thereof, a user may directly apply a pulling force on the pull unit to move the locking unit rearward and accordingly easily pull the connector out of the shielding cage without damaging the connector.

    Abstract: A light guiding structure for connector includes a light-guiding unit having more than one light guiding post, and each of the light guiding posts having a light-input end and a light-output end; and a shielding unit enclosing an outer side of the light guiding posts. When the light guiding structure is mounted on a connector case for guiding light, light beams propagating in different light guiding posts are isolated from one another by the shielding unit. Therefore, light beams can be stably and exactly guided by the light guiding posts without light loss and mutual interference to thereby avoid error determination by a user.

    Abstract: A connector housing structure includes a case defining an open end on at least one side thereof and having a plurality of partitioning plates vertically erected therein, and the partitioning plates each having an end facing toward and corresponding to the open end; a plurality of central elastic leaves being provided at the end of the partitioning plates facing toward the open end; and a fastening frame being fitted around the open end of the case and internally provided with a plurality of supporting posts separately corresponding to a free end of the central elastic leaves. With the fastening frame fitted around the open end of the case, the central elastic leaves can be stably held in place, and the case can have increased structural strength and be more easily manufactured at reduced cost.

    Abstract: A plug-type connector includes a connector main body having a first end formed into a plug portion and an opposite second end formed into a pull portion; a pinch unit movably coupled to the pull portion, and having at least a vertical plate corresponding to an end face of the pull portion and a pinch plate perpendicularly extended from the vertical plate and corresponding to a back face of the pull portion; and an elastic element located between the back face of the pull portion and the pinch plate. Two plug-type connectors can be plugged in a two-leveled housing back to back. The connector main bodies are normally firmly connected to the housing by the pinch units, and any one of the two connector main bodies can be easily removed from the housing simply by pulling the pinch unit thereof without being interfered by the other pinch unit.

    Abstract: A connector EMI shielding structure includes an enclosure having a front open end and a rear end closed by a back plate, and being provided on two sidewalls with a bent hook each; and a shielding unit for fitting around the front open end of the enclosure. The shielding unit includes a top panel, two side panels, and two bottom panels. Each of the top panel, the side panels, and the bottom panels of the shielding unit is formed with an opening, from an inner edge of which one or more elastic leaves are extended rearward for elastically pressing against the enclosure. And, each of the side panels of the shielding unit is provided on a rear edge with a cut for engaging with the bent hooks on the sidewalls of the enclosure. With these arrangements, the shielding unit can be easily and firmly assembled to the enclosure.

    Abstract: A plug connector includes a main body having a forward plug head for plugging in a corresponding receptacle, and an axial middle slide way having a lowered section formed on a top surface; an elastic plate fixed to a rear end of the main body with two hooks formed at a front free end for engaging with two engaging holes on the receptacle; and a pull member having a forward projected section movably located in the middle slide way below the elastic plate. When the pull member is pulled rearward, a downward protruded front end of the forward projected section slides out of the lowered section onto the middle slide way to raise a middle section of the elastic plate, so that the hooks of the elastic plate disengage from the receptacle, allowing the plug head of the main body to unplug from the receptacle.

    Abstract: A connector includes an insulated base having a plurality of conductive terminals inserted onto a top thereof, and an insulated cover being structured to firmly hold a flat cable to the base. The base is provided at the top with a row of spacers to form a plurality of parallelly spaced slots, into which the conductive terminals are separately seated to partially expose from the top of the base. The flat cable is stripped at a predetermined section to expose a length of naked cores that are separately located in the spaced slots above the conductive terminals and are welded to the latter to provide increased contact areas between the terminals and the flat cable to ensure stable signal transmission at high speed. The spacers prevent the occurrence of short circuit during welding of the terminals to the naked cores of the flat cable.

    Abstract: A connector includes a plastic body, a front part of which is covered with a steel case and a rear part of which has an insertion plate connected thereto. A common ground connection means is associated with a rear side of the insertion plate by locating staggered upper and lower common ground terminals at the front edge of the common ground connection means in some of the terminal slots on the insertion plate to thereby electrically contact with rear ends of connection terminals provided on the plastic body and seated in the same terminal slots. Ground wires in multiple-core cables are connected to the terminal slots that have both the common ground terminal and the connection terminal seated therein and other information wires in the multiple-core cables are connected to the terminal slots that have only the connection terminal seated therein. Thereby, noise interference may be effectively reduced and transmission speed may be increased.
